Yes Crufts is on for 4 days with the breeds split into groups.  To see the Rotties you need to go on Day 1 - Thursday.  This is the schedule for the other activities on that day.
http://www.crufts.org.uk/whats-on/day1  It looks as though Mini Agility is in the arena around lunch time.

Rottweilers will be in Hall 5,provisional order of showing is rings 31 dogs and 32 Bitches and judging will start at 9.00am(Thursday as already said.)
Programme of events can be found here  http://www.crufts.org.uk/whats-on/day1
Have a lovely day,bring plenty of money and sensible footwear,and if you have time pop over to the ring right next door (33) for the Canadian Eskimos - though we are 5th on!!So Long day.
